What is Gunmetal Finish?

Gunmetal finish, a term that evokes a sense of strength and sophistication, refers to a dark, cool gray metallic hue with subtle undertones. Originally formulated as a blend of copper, tin, and zinc, gunmetal is typically associated with durability and high resistance to corrosion. In jewelry, this finish is often achieved through various methods such as electroplating or using tungsten carbide, resulting in sleek textures that appeal to many men who prefer an understated yet striking aesthetic.

Materials Used in Gunmetal Wedding Bands for Men

Tungsten vs. Titanium: A Comparison

Two popular materials for gunmetal wedding bands are tungsten and titanium, each possessing unique properties. Tungsten carbide is renowned for its impressive hardness, making it highly scratch-resistant. Its dense composition also ensures a heavy, “substantial” feel. In contrast, titanium is lightweight, hypoallergenic, and resistant to corrosion, appealing to those seeking comfort and practicality. While tungsten provides a high-end, luxurious appeal, titanium offers everyday wearability without compromising style.

Durability and Maintenance of Gunmetal Bands

One of the standout benefits of gunmetal wedding bands is their durability. Apart from being scratch-resistant, gunmetal finishes typically maintain their color over time, resisting fading or dullness. Basic maintenance is easy; gentle cleaning with soapy water and a soft cloth suffices to keep the ring looking pristine. Avoiding harsh chemicals or abrasive materials ensures the band remains lustrous and intact, preserving its beauty for years to come.
